If (a tad out of place on this list) I may extend the subject to
include singers, I personally, after first hearing Georges Thill singing
the great recit.+aria of Enee in Les Troyens, can receive very little
satisfaction from the Vickers, Villars, Goulds, Heppners and other would
be realizers of the role.

What does this mean?  Most of the few who care about Les Troyens adore
not only Vickers and Heppner but now Kunde.  To me they get less and
less significant.

It means little except that I do not believe I will ever find a performance
of one of my favorite operas which I can enjoy.
